How they compare

Colombia currently reports 66.3% against 65.0% in Sao Tome and Principe, a difference of 1.3%.

Across all 6 years both countries report, Colombia has been ahead every year.

Colombia ranks 104th and Sao Tome and Principe ranks 107th of 185 countries.

Colombia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Colombia Sao Tome and Principe Difference Ahead
2000s 75.7% 41.1% 34.6% Colombia
2010s 83.8% 62.9% 20.9% Colombia
2020s 69.9% 66.1% 3.9% Colombia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Number of female deaths due to non-communicable diseases divided by number of all female deaths, expressed by percentage. Non-Communicable diseases include cancer, diabetes mellitus, cardiovascular diseases, digestive diseases, skin diseases, musculoskeletal diseases, and congenital anomalies.
